I like the location. Its on a quiet area yet very near to everything. There's a bus service going to the city centre of Cannes which is only 3 stops away. Or you can walk on your left about 5-10 minutes and there will be another city center (can't remember the name) where restaurants, church, supermarket are. The hotel has also a swimming pool. The moldy smell of the bathroom. It must be the shower curtain. There is also some paint peeling on the bathroom (bottom of door). The vents are also dirty. The bathroom tiles needs to be scrubbed. In our 2 nights stay, when they do the housekeeping, they did not change the bedsheet nor replace plastic liners on garbage cans... And the carpet needs vaccuuming. |

Quiet room - I chose a "Garden Facing" room which was exactly that - pleasant view whilst avoiding intermittant noise from nearby trains. Staff were pleasant and helpful when I had problems parking my car. Outdoor pool was well-appointed and relaxing. Access to cheap/frequent public transport was a bonus. Breakfasts & Bar prices were excessive ("fair") - so I did not use them and tended to eat/drink locally |
